Description

• Design high-converting static assets that align with the client's target audience and campaign objectives. • Oversee the complete design process, from initial concept development to the final delivery, ensuring quality and consistency. • Leverage Photoshop for basic photo manipulation, cropping people/assets from backgrounds, and retouching. • Collaborate with copywriters, media buyers, and strategists to integrate text and visuals seamlessly, enhancing the overall impact of the ads. • Use data-driven insights to refine designs and optimize their performance across all advertising channels. • Prepare and export design assets tailored for various platforms, including banner display ads, social media ads, and YouTube thumbnails. • Maintain organized source files for easy access and collaboration within the team. • Provide design support for other marketing initiatives as needed.

Requirements

• Up-to-date portfolio demonstrating past work experience creating static assets for paid advertising. • Minimum of 3 years in graphic design, with a focus on creating digital advertising materials. • Expertise in using Adobe Creative Suite. • Understanding of fundamental design principles such as typography, layout design, and color theory. • Proven track record in direct response design, creating graphics that capture attention and drive conversions. • Excellent English communication—both written and verbal. • Ability to manage quick project turnarounds and thrive under stringent deadlines. • Ability to work collaboratively within a team and take constructive feedback.
